前端做网站都要做哪些?全面解析关键步骤与技巧
在当今数字化时代,拥有一个功能完善、用户体验优秀的网站是企业或个人展示形象的重要途径。前端开发作为网站建设的核心环节,涉及从页面设计到交互实现的全过程。那么,前端做网站都要做哪些工作?本文将围绕这一主题,为你梳理关键步骤与实用技巧,帮助开发者高效完成项目。
1. 需求分析与原型设计
前端开发的第一步是明确需求。与客户或产品经理沟通,确定网站的目标用户、核心功能和设计风格。随后,通过工具如Figma或Sketch制作低保真原型,规划页面布局和交互流程。这一阶段需重点关注响应式设计,确保网站在不同设备上都能正常显示。
2. 技术选型与开发环境搭建
根据项目复杂度选择合适的技术栈。基础前端开发通常使用HTML、CSS和JavaScript,而复杂项目可引入React、Vue等框架提升效率。配置开发环境(如VS Code、Git版本控制)和构建工具(如Webpack、Vite),优化代码编译与打包流程,为后续开发奠定基础。
3. 页面开发与功能实现
进入编码阶段后,需完成静态页面构建和动态功能开发。通过HTML搭建结构,CSS实现视觉效果(如动画、渐变),JavaScript处理用户交互(如表单验证、数据请求)。需调用API接口获取后端数据,并利用Axios或Fetch库实现前后端通信。注意代码可维护性,合理拆分组件或模块。
4. 测试优化与性能提升
开发完成后,需进行多维度测试:使用Chrome DevTools调试兼容性问题,通过Lighthouse评估性能得分,并针对加载速度、SEO友好性等指标优化。常见措施包括压缩资源文件、启用缓存、减少DOM操作等。移动端需额外测试触控交互与适配效果。
5. 部署上线与持续维护
将代码部署至服务器或云平台(如Netlify、Vercel),配置域名和HTTPS证书。上线后需监控运行状态,定期更新内容或修复漏洞。对于长期项目,可引入CI/CD流程实现自动化部署,提升团队协作效率。
总结来说,前端做网站需要系统化完成需求分析、技术开发、测试优化和部署维护全流程。掌握这些核心步骤,结合行业最佳实践,才能打造出高性能、高体验的现代化网站。无论是初学者还是资深开发者,持续关注新技术与用户需求变化,是保持竞争力的关键。

评论(0)